You heard it here first, folks: Tracer is still the face of Overwatch, despite not being featured in many major collaborations or promotional materials as of late.
We got the chance to sit down with the minds behind Overwatch at Blizzcon 2026 to discuss the game’s newest support hero, Doctrine, and the future of the franchise — as well as grill them about Tracer’s role as its supposed mascot.
When you think about Overwatch, you probably think of Tracer. She was essentially the star of the show when the game first launched in 2016, and was consistently featured in marketing materials, merchandise, advertisements, and more. Her iconic silhouette and speedy abilities were inescapable back then… but now, not so much.
We directly asked Overwatch’s Lead Hero Producer Kenny Hudson, as well as art director Dion Rogers, if Tracer is still the mascot of the game — or if she was ever really considered its mascot, at all.
Their answer was firm and decisive: Tracer is, and always was, the mascot of Overwatch.
